What causes inflammation in joint pain?

Inflammation is a common response when joint tissues are injured or affected by disease. It can result from acute trauma (sprains or fractures), chronic mechanical stress (osteoarthritis), or immune-driven conditions (rheumatoid arthritis, psoriatic arthritis). Inflammatory chemicals in the joint can cause swelling, warmth, stiffness, and pain, and prolonged inflammation may damage cartilage and other structures. Identifying whether joint pain is primarily inflammatory versus mechanical helps guide treatment choices — for example, anti-inflammatory medications and disease-modifying therapies are important for immune-mediated conditions, while mechanical issues may need physical therapy and lifestyle changes.

When is injection used for joint pain?

Injections are often used when conservative measures do not provide sufficient relief or when localized treatment is needed. Corticosteroid injections reduce inflammation and can relieve pain for weeks to months in many people, but effects vary by condition and joint. Other injectable options include hyaluronic acid for some types of knee osteoarthritis and biologic therapies or platelet-rich plasma in selected cases; availability and evidence differ by treatment and condition. Injections carry risks such as infection or temporary flare, so clinicians typically weigh benefits and risks and discuss expectations before proceeding. Repeat injections are generally limited based on clinical guidelines.

How does physical therapy relieve joint pain?

Physical therapy focuses on restoring movement, increasing strength around affected joints, improving balance, and teaching strategies to reduce joint stress. A therapist evaluates gait, posture, range of motion, and muscle weaknesses, then prescribes tailored exercises, manual techniques, and activity modifications. Physical therapy can reduce pain, delay progression of some conditions, and improve function without medication. It is commonly recommended for osteoarthritis, tendinopathy, and after joint injuries or surgery. What role does exercise have in joint pain management?

Appropriate exercise is a cornerstone of joint pain management. Low-impact aerobic activities (walking, cycling, swimming), targeted strengthening, flexibility work, and balance training help reduce pain and improve function. Exercise can decrease inflammatory markers in some conditions, support weight management (which reduces joint load), and enhance circulation for tissue health. Programs should be individualized: short, frequent sessions and gradual progression often work better than intense, unsupervised routines. If pain increases significantly with activity, pause and consult a clinician or physical therapist to adjust the plan and rule out worsening structural problems.

How do medications and self-care fit into treatment?

Medications range from topical creams and oral analgesics to prescription anti-inflammatory drugs and disease-modifying agents for autoimmune arthritis. Over-the-counter nonsteroidal anti-inflammatory drugs (NSAIDs) may ease mild to moderate pain but have potential side effects that should be discussed with a healthcare provider. Topical NSAIDs or capsaicin can be alternatives for localized pain. Self-care strategies include weight management, ergonomic adjustments, pacing activities, heat and cold therapy, and assistive devices for joint protection. For chronic or progressive joint pain, clinicians may recommend a combination of medications, structured physical therapy, and lifestyle measures tailored to the diagnosis and individual goals.
